Michael Choate Obituary

Visit the Bohm-Calarco-Smith Funeral Home - Batavia website to view the full obituary.
Michael Jon Choate passed away on September 24, 2025. A lifelong sports and outdoor enthusiast, he found joy in tennis, golf, softball, basketball, bowling, cheering on the Buffalo Bills, and making cherished annual trips with his family to the Outer Banks, NC. For over 40 years, Mike served as Oakfield's beloved town pharmacist, becoming a well-known and deeply valued member of the community. His warm sense of humor and big heart endeared him to a wide circle of friends, extended family, and most of all, his devoted wife, Roxie.

He is survived by his children: Christopher Choate and his wife Michelle Perrin Choate of Alexander; David Choate and his wife Stephanie Mogavero of Spencerport; and Jennifer Choate Batchellor and her husband Aaron Batchellor of Houston. He was a proud grandfather to Nick Choate, Emily (Choate) Patrick, Natalie Choate, Ryan Choate, Jackson Batchellor, Camden Batchellor, and John Choate. He is also fondly remembered by many nieces and nephews.

A visitation will be held on November 29 from 11:00 AM to 1:00 PM at Bohm-Calarco-Smith Funeral Home, 308 East Main Street, Batavia, followed by a graveside service at Reed Cemetery in Oakfield. A celebration of Mike's life will take place at the Caryville Inn, 25 Main Street, Oakfield from 2:00 PM to 6:00 PM. Please dress in your Bills gear.
